Output 5e73dba276c3ef4bf3426e2068ab042e883806adeec015193f8f85723125a9f3:19

value
40226881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f98ca6b7b64aac88abb3828bea2b9596ea69a35 OP_EQUAL
address
MLzRtwpoxsrT5Y17nCweKkkyPf8UFPhhb7
transaction
5e73dba276c3ef4bf3426e2068ab042e883806adeec015193f8f85723125a9f3
spent
true